A Bank Teller II is responsible for providing exceptional customer service by performing various banking transactions. They greet customers, answer inquiries, and assist with account-related activities such as deposits, withdrawals, and loan payments. Bank Teller IIs handle cash transactions accurately, ensuring that the correct amount is disbursed or received. They also process checks, money orders, and traveler's checks, while promoting bank products and services to customers. Additionally, Bank Teller IIs may be responsible for balancing cash drawers, preparing daily financial reports, and resolving any customer issues or discrepancies.

Bank Teller Ii salary in Afghanistan
Average Yearly Salary of Bank Teller Ii in Afghanistan is approximately 274,265 AFN (2,988 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Afghanistan is a landlocked country located in South Asia. It has a population of approximately 38 million people and covers an area of around 652,230 square kilometers. The country is bordered by Pakistan to the east and south, Iran to the west, Turkmenistan, Uzbekistan, and Tajikistan to the north, and China to the northeast.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 507,000 AFN (6,000 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Bank Teller Ii job salary compared to average salary in Afghanistan.
Comparison shows that a person working as Bank Teller Ii in Afghanistan earns on average:
0.54 times the average salary (or 54% of average salary).
